Which Class C (Alcove) RVs are best for couples in Anchorage?

Class C RVs are an excellent balanced choice for couples seeking comfort, amenities, and relatively easy driving for their Anchorage exploration. These motorhomes, like the "24' Class C Motorhome" from some suppliers, typically feature a bed over the cab and a rear master bed, providing a comfortable sleeping area for two. With an average length of 7.8 meters and comfortably sleeping 4-6 people (designed for 4.6 adults in some configurations), they offer more space than campervans without the bulk of a Class A. Fuel consumption for a Class C typically ranges from 23-30L/100km, which is a factor for budgeting on longer Alaskan routes, but they handle diverse road conditions well. These are perfect for couples who appreciate dedicated dining and lounge areas, plus a private bathroom, allowing for convenient cooking with a 3-burner gas stove and refrigeration of fresh Alaskan ingredients on your journey. Which Class TC (Truck Camper) RVs are best for couples in Anchorage?

Class TC truck campers offer adventurous couples unparalleled flexibility and off-grid capability for exploring Anchorage and beyond. These robust units, like the "Patagonia Camper 4x4 double cab" or "rv rental usa example T17 Truck Camper" average 6 meters in length and comfortably sleep 2 adults. They are typically mounted on a 4-wheel drive truck base, making them exceptionally well-suited for rugged Alaskan terrain and accessing more remote boondocking spots or trailheads that conventional RVs might struggle with. A unique advantage is that many truck campers can detach from the truck, allowing you to set up camp and then use the truck for day trips to explore areas like the Matanuska Glacier or Talkeetna without moving your entire setup. This makes a truck camper an excellent choice for couples desiring true wilderness immersion with the convenience of a compact, mobile base.

What You Shouldn't Miss

  • Drive the Seward Highway: Start your scenic journey directly from Anchorage on the Seward Highway, consistently ranked among the most beautiful drives in the US, offering breathtaking coastal and mountain views almost immediately outside the city.
  • Wildlife Viewing at Potter Marsh: Just 10 miles south of downtown Anchorage on the Seward Highway, easily pull off with your RV and walk the boardwalks at Potter Marsh Bird Sanctuary to observe migratory birds, moose, and beavers in their natural habitat.
  • Explore Earthquake Park: Visit Earthquake Park on the western edge of Anchorage to learn about the dramatic 1964 Good Friday earthquake while enjoying panoramic views of Cook Inlet and the Alaska Range – a perfect, educational stop for history buffs.
  • Watch Seaplanes at Lake Hood: Head to Lake Hood Seaplane Base, the world's busiest, to witness hundreds of iconic Alaskan bush planes take off and land on the water daily. It’s a captivating and unique local spectacle, easily accessible from Anchorage's airport area.
  • Discover Local Flavors at Anchorage Farmers Markets: Immerse yourselves in local culture and find fresh ingredients for your RV kitchen at one of Anchorage's vibrant farmers' markets, such as the Anchorage Market on 3rd Avenue or the South Anchorage Farmers Market.
  • Hike in Chugach State Park: Take advantage of Anchorage's urban-wilderness blend by hiking one of the numerous trails in Chugach State Park, just a short drive from the city center. Trails like Flattop Mountain offer stunning vistas perfect for couples.

Where is the nearest dump station to Anchorage airport

The nearest public dump station to Anchorage International Airport ANC can be found at Cabelas on C Street which is approximately a 10-minute drive from the airport Many RV parks in and around Anchorage also offer dump station facilities for their guests

What are winter tire requirements driving from Anchorage

While specific winter tire requirements may vary based on road conditions and the season it is strongly recommended that any RV traveling from Anchorage in late fall winter or early spring be equipped with winter-rated tires or chains especially for routes like the Seward Highway that can experience heavy snowfall Always check local road conditions before driving

Which campground near Anchorage has the best views for couples

For couples seeking stunning views Bird Creek Campground located about 25 miles south of Anchorage on the Seward Highway offers picturesque sites overlooking Turnagain Arm and the Chugach Mountains ideal for romantic sunsets and wildlife spotting

How far in advance should I book my Anchorage RV rental

For travel during the peak season of June through August we strongly recommend booking your motorhome 6 to 9 months in advance Alaskas rental fleet is limited and demand is high during these months Booking early ensures the best selection of vehicles and more favorable pricing

Whats included in the daily price

The daily rental rate typically includes the vehicle standard liability insurance and basic kitchen and vehicle equipment Mileage packages bedding kits and other extras are usually added separately You can upgrade to a top-level deductible for extra peace of mind but this is an optional add-on not included in the base price

Do I need a special licence for a motorhome in Anchorage

No a special license is not required to rent any motorhome in Anchorage A standard valid car drivers license from your home country is sufficient for all vehicle classes including large Class A and Class C models For visitors from non-English-speaking countries an International Driving Permit IDP is recommended but not mandatory

When is the best time to take an RV trip in Anchorage

The prime season for an RV trip starting in Anchorage is from late May to early September During this period youll experience long daylight hours the midnight sun warmer temperatures and better access to roads and attractions While June July and August are the most popular months the shoulder seasons of late May and early September can offer fewer crowds and more affordable rates
